Driving Toward Independence – José’s Momentum Story

Andrew Skinner noviembre 10, 2023 News, Noteworthy, SCI, Triumph Outreach Update

"It's mind-blowing. I wasn't expecting this at all."

Some of the most motivating people I know aren’t satisfied overcoming their own obstacles; they crush them on the way to helping others overcome their obstacles as well.

José is one of those obstacle-crushers, who I’m thrilled to call my friend.

From a young age, José grappled with severe scoliosis, enduring excruciating pain, bullying and a search for answers. At age 18, he underwent a lengthy surgery to address the issue, but a mistake left him paraplegic.

Recently, he faced another setback – he was hit by a car, which added to his physical and financial burdens.

Despite his challenges, José has found strength to pursue a positive impact by helping others with similar stories. He has become a pillar of support for his fellow wheelchair users, commuting tirelessly on busses and trains across Southern California to lead a support group as a Triumph Lead Ambassador at The Perfect Step and works selling water purifiers for Kangen Water .

José recently applied to be considered for an adapted vehicle, which would be a key factor in gaining more independence and his ability to get to his job and physical therapy.
